phpbar.de logo

Mailinglisten-Archive

[php] =?iso-8859-1?Q?Re:_=5Bphp=5D_=5Bphp=5D_Variable_anh=E4ngen?=

[php] Re: [php] [php] Variable anhängen

Joerg Behrens php_(at)_phpcenter.de
Sun, 9 Dec 2001 11:39:59 +0100


Moin,

----- Original Message -----
From: "]C[ubic//<.LU>" <sgoffine_(at)_pt.lu>
To: <php_(at)_phpcenter.de>
Sent: Sunday, December 09, 2001 11:15 AM
Subject: [php] [php] Variable anhängen


> Hi,
>
> hab folgendes Problem:
>
> Ich habe ein ganz banales Formular:
>
> <form method="POST" action="script1.php">
>   Auswahl
>   <input type="radio" name="R1" value="wahl1" checked >Text
>   <input type="radio" name="R1" value="wahl2">Text
>   <input type="radio" name="R1" value="wahl3">Text
>   <input type="submit" value="Abschicken">
> </form>
>
> Die Ausgabe an script1.php sieht also folgenmassen aus:
> >./web/script1.php?r1="wahl*"<

Nein so sieht das bestimmt nicht aus.... da du method="POST" genommen hast
werden die Daten im Body verschickt.  Du haettest 'GET' nehmen muessen um
das gewuenschte zu bekommen. Dabei aber daran denken das VARS ueber die URL
codiert werden muessen da nicht alle Zeichen dort zugelassen sind. (hinweis:
umlaute, whitespace usw.). Aus diesem bequemen Grund und auch weil die
Laenge einer URL gegrenzt ist wird meistens "Post" verwendent.

 Nun möchte ich aber noch eine Variable dranhängen, die nicht durch das
> Formular bestimmt wurde. So soll das Aussehen:
> >./web/script1.php?r1="wahl*"&anderevar="wert"<

Du koenntest einen Hiddenfield machen oder aber
<form method="POST" action="script1.php?anderevar=var">
machen.

Gruss
Joerg behrens

ps: Ausgruenden der Hoeflichkeit posten die Leute hier unter Verwendung
ihres Realnamens.. das erhoeht auch die Anzahl der moeglichen Anworten um
ein vielfaches.

--
TakeNet GmbH                        Mobil: 0171/60 57 963
D-97080 Wuerzburg                 Tel: +49 931 903-2243
Alfred-Nobel-Straße 20            Fax: +49 931 903-3025


php::bar PHP Wiki   -   Listenarchive